PHOTO My rebuild of this 2005 Mongoose. More info below

Thumbnail
gallery
3 Upvotes

Third pic is before I started

I was given this 2005 Mongoose Wildcard that sat outside for around 15 years. I wanted to keep it as original as possible. I cleaned as much rust off as I could and resprayed a bunch of stuff. New tires and tubes. The chain and brakes were replaced. Now all thats left is to get new pegs and brake lines.

I know its just a Mongoose but its my first rebuild. Thought I should show it off

DISCUSSION Backyard track coming along

Thumbnail
gallery
40 Upvotes

Not a mtb track but you all may be able to help.

Please give any pointers. Lots of work still to do

I’m using infield mix, concrete for bases and a few large logs wrapped in a tarp for the berms

Each roller is 10:1 and the berms are roughly 3ft tall with 10ft turn radius

I want to add a few double rollers as well and need to modify entry and exit of the berms.

Advice is welcomed! Been a ton of fun and tons of work so far but coming along. Kinda rideable for now
